摘 要:目前ZigBee协议是无线传感网络中的常用通信协议,而ZigBee协议的网络层主要有Cluster-Tree和AODVjr两种路由协议。论文主要研究AODVjr路由协议,该协议存在容易引起广播风暴以及故障路由生存时间较长的缺点。论文针对AODVjr的缺点对其作了研究改进,改进的主要目的是降低路由开销。利用NS2进行的仿真实验结果表明,改进后的AODVjr路由算法能有效节约网络的整体能量。At present,ZigBee protocol is mainly applied in wireless sensor network.However,it is easier to arouse a broadcast storm when using the AODVjr routing algorithm.According to the characteristics of AODVjr algorithm,that is,route-requesting command frame structure and the route-replying command frame structure,an improved AODVjr routing algorithm is designed.The routing protocol was improved by reducing redundant routing request packet(RREQ)and shortening the lifetime of failure routes,in this way,the routing overhead of the protocol can be reduced.The simulation result by using NS2shows that the improved AODVjr routing protocol can effectively reduce overhead of the network.
